在稀H2SO4介质中,铌灵敏催化KBrO3氧化偶氮氯膦 mA的褪色反应,据此建立了催化动力学光度法测定铌的新方法。线性范围为5~30ng mL,检出限0.292ng mL。本法已用于矿石试样中微量铌的测定。
A new catalytic method for the determination of trace niobium was developed with spectrophotometry. It was based on the catalytic effect of Nb(Ⅴ) on the oxidation of chlorophosponazo-mA by potassium bromate in sulphuric acid medium. The linear range of (Nb(Ⅴ)) was 5~30 ng/mL, and the detection limit was 0.292 (ng/mL). The method was applied to the determination of niobium in ore samples with satisfactory results.
